Note - Surnames: Darr, Frazor, Kiser, Kizer, Kyser, McMurtry, Ruyle

Note: The following documents were found in the Sumner County Court records.

Know all men by these presents that we Moses Rule and Betsy Rule his wife, James Darr & Sallyhis wife, Philip Kizer and Daniel Kyzer heirs or Legatees of Philip Kyser deceased for & in consideration of nine hundred and sixty two dollars to us in hand paid the receipt of which we hereby acknowledge have granted bargained & sold unto George W. Frazor [husband of Mary Polly Kizer, Philip's daughter] a piece or tract of land situate in Sumner County and State of Tennessee waters of Drakes Creek. Beginning a white oak on the North bank of the branch in the old line of Frazors preemption, thence south with said line eighty six poles to a beech in Minters line, thence North with his line sixty two poles to his Corner, then West eighty two poles to a stake, thence East with said line one hundred and twenty eight poles to a branch, thence down said branch south eastwardly to Shelbys old line, thence south with said line fifty eight poles to old line of Frazors of preemption then west four poles to his old corner, thence south with his line thirty six poles to the Beginning. Containing by estimation one hundred and twenty seven acres and one third unto the said George W. Frazors his heirs or assigns forever all our right title interest claim or demand of in to or out of the above described land or bargained premises of us our heirs as heirs or legatees of the late Philip Kizer deceased. In witness whereof we hereunto set our hands and seals this sixteenth day of September 1829.

We do certify that we examined Betsy Rule and Sally Darr for the signers to the within deed and they severly acknowledged that they signed them for the purposes therein names of their own free will without any force or Compulsion from their respective husbands or any other persons.

Wm. Montgomery J.P. S.C.
John McMurtry J.P. S.C.

Sumner County Court November Term 1829
This deed of bargain and sale from Moses Rule Betsy Rule James Darr Sally Darr Philip Kisor John Kisor and Daniel Kisor to George W. Frazor for one hundred and one third acres of land was duly proved in open Court by the oath of John McMurty & Philip Kisor two of the subscribing witnesses hereto and ordered to be registered A Copy
